Former Chiefs Player Shares His Opinion On Chiefs Targets Mbule & Sithebe!

Former Kaizer Chiefs midfielder Junior Khanye has given his opinion on Amakhosi’s reported transfer targets Siyethemba Sithebe and Sipho Mbule.

Both players have been closely linked with the Glamour Boys even though it remains to be seen whether either will land at Naturena.

Khanye has questioned the potential arrival of Sithebe, who has featured in 20 games for Usuthu this season.

“I heard rumours of Sithebe to Kaizer Chiefs. What has he done for AmaZulu,” he told iDiski Times.

“What has he done to be bought, not even as a free agent. What has he done? What impact is he going to bring at Kaizer Chiefs?

Meanwhile, Khanye raved about the quality of SuperSport United’s Mbule, saying he’d be a signing who would excite him.

“What a player, me I like boys who are proper developed. Whoever developed that boy has done well. He was born to play football, he breathes football.

“He’s arrogant on the ball, very clever, skilful, can score goals. Technically he’s good. He plays with both feet. I don’t understand why Hugo Broos is not playing his for Bafana Bafana.

“Mbule, if Chiefs can buy him, wow. And then you get a defensive midfielder like [Teboho] Mokoena. Even if they bring him in alone, he’s going to change.

“He’s a star player, if they sign him, I can be excited.”
